Dielectric properties of single crystals of LaGaO3have been measured at low frequencies as well as in the microwave region over a wide temperature range. Measurements performed on two crystal orientations, viz. (001) and (110), show dielectric anomalies at a transition near 145thinsp;deg;C. Dielectric anisotropy below, but not above, 145thinsp;deg;C confirm the previously reported orthorhombic symmetry at room temperature and rhombohedral symmetry above 145thinsp;deg;C. Domain wall motion which arises as a result of a phase transition has been observed around 145thinsp;deg;C.
